Mold Inspection in Crawl Spaces
Ignoring the potential for mold development in your crawl space can lead to substantial structural damage and health risks. Periodic crawl space mold assessment is essential for early discovery and prompt remediation. Professional companies utilize advanced equipment, such as air quality monitors, to locate mold areas of concern. If mold is found, a comprehensive cleanup strategy should be carried out, which may involve addressing moisture origins, removing contaminated materials, and employing fungicidal treatments to prevent future recurrence.
